PUBG: Survival, Adventure, and Teamwork Perfectly Combined

Since its launch in 2017, PUBG: Battlegrounds (commonly known as “PUBG” or “PlayerUnknown’s Battlegrounds”) has quickly become a global phenomenon. The game not only pioneered a new era for the battle royale genre but also attracted millions of players with its highly open, tense, and immersive survival experience.

In PUBG, up to 100 players compete on the same map. After choosing a drop location from an airplane, players enter a vast and dangerous island. The core objective is survival: from scavenging weapons, armor, and medical supplies to facing sudden encounters with enemies, every decision could determine whether you survive until the end. As the safe zone gradually shrinks, tension rises, and even a momentary lapse can result in a “headshot” ending.

Beyond intense solo survival, PUBG emphasizes adventure and strategic thinking. Each map features unique terrain, cities, rivers, and cover points, requiring players not only to outsmart opponents but also to leverage terrain, weather, and timing in their tactics. You can choose to lie in ambush or take bold risks; each match is an unpredictable adventure, and every parachute drop is a brand-new challenge.

A particularly notable aspect is the depth of teamwork. PUBG supports duo and squad modes, where voice communication, tactical coordination, and resource allocation are key to victory. Here, success depends not only on individual aim but also on team synergy and strategic execution. It is this perfect blend of survival, adventure, and teamwork that makes PUBG not just a shooting game but a thrilling, immersive competitive experience.

2. Exploring an Unknown Adventure World

PUBG is more than a survival competition—it is a journey of adventure and exploration. The game offers multiple meticulously designed maps, each with unique terrain, climate, and strategic characteristics, ensuring fresh experiences and unpredictability every match:

  • Erangel: The classic map and PUBG’s starting point. It features expansive forests, dense towns, and open farmland, offering diverse tactical options. Players can ambush in city buildings or snipe across open fields, making each encounter dynamic and challenging.
  • Miramar: A desert map with vast arid terrain and rugged hills. Combat often occurs at long range, emphasizing sniping and vehicle use. Players must skillfully use terrain for cover while mastering driving skills to survive under harsh sun and dust.
  • Sanhok: A smaller tropical island with fast-paced combat and frequent encounters. Dense jungles, rivers, and small villages demand rapid decisions and agile movement. Each match can escalate into intense firefights within minutes, combining adventure and tension.
  • Vikendi: A snowy map integrating ice and snow into combat. Slippery surfaces affect movement and combat, and footprints in the snow can reveal or track players. Environmental factors influence both positioning and strategy.

Beyond terrain, the layout of buildings, roads, and loot placement is carefully designed to encourage experimentation with tactics and exploration routes. Players might discover rare loot in abandoned factories or scout entire battlefields from mountaintops to plan ambushes. Map design deepens strategy while making each match an unpredictable adventure—you never know what enemy or event will appear next.

Exploring PUBG’s maps challenges tactical thinking while fueling a sense of adventure. Each parachute drop, patrol, or scouting mission is a fresh experience, with freedom and unpredictability keeping players immersed in the island’s survival tension.

3. Diverse Gameplay Mechanics

PUBG’s appeal lies not only in tense survival but also in rich and varied gameplay, which adds strategy and variability:

1. Weapons and Equipment

PUBG offers a variety of weapons: rifles, sniper rifles, submachine guns, pistols, melee weapons, and throwables. Each weapon has unique range, recoil, and trajectory, requiring players to choose according to the environment. Armor and medical supplies are crucial for survival—from light vests to full body armor, from first-aid kits to bandages, every item can save your life. Players constantly balance the weight and utility of equipment, adding strategic depth.

2. Vehicle System

In addition to walking, players can use vehicles to move quickly or execute tactical maneuvers. Options include motorcycles, jeeps, cars, and even armored vehicles, each with varying speed and protection. Vehicles can serve as cover or offensive tools—for example, ramming enemy positions at high speed or shielding teammates during retreat.

3. Environmental Interaction

Players can use buildings, rocks, and trees for ambush or defense, or leverage terrain to flank enemies. Terrain affects vision and movement speed: high ground offers sniper advantage, while grass and forests are ideal for stealth. Weather and day-night cycles further enhance strategic complexity—rain or fog reduces visibility, favoring stealth attacks.

4. Varied Game Modes

PUBG offers more than the classic battle royale:

  • Team Deathmatch: Emphasizes teamwork and strategy.
  • Event Modes: Limited-time variants with unique weapon or vehicle modifications for added fun.
  • Training Mode: A safe environment to practice shooting, throwables, and vehicle handling, ideal for beginners.

This variety ensures that every match feels different, appealing to solo players and strategic teams alike.

5. Top-Tier Graphics and Immersion

PUBG pursues realism and immersion in both graphics and sound:

1. Realistic Style

PUBG uses a realistic approach to environments and characters. Every building, terrain, and weapon model is designed to mimic reality. Broken urban structures, wild vegetation, and vehicle damage details all create a convincing battlefield. Even small elements, like window reflections or mud footprints, provide visual cues that affect tactics.

2. Light, Shadow, and Weather

Dynamic day-night cycles and weather systems make each match unique. Sunlight can reveal your position, while darkness offers ambush opportunities. Rain, fog, and snow influence visibility, movement, and sound, adding tactical layers.

3. High-Quality Textures and Animations

Weapons, vehicles, and character actions are finely detailed. Recoil, bullet trajectory, and reload animations are realistically simulated; vehicle movement, skidding, and collisions feel authentic; character running, crouching, and rolling animations are fluid. Players can intuitively feel the effect of every shot and move.

4. Sound Design

Audio serves as crucial tactical information. Accurate gunfire, explosions, and footsteps help gauge enemy distance and direction. Environmental sounds like rain, wind, and vehicles enhance immersion and situational awareness.

This combination of visuals and audio creates a fully immersive experience, making PUBG more than just a shooter—it’s a full-fledged survival battlefield simulation.

6. Platforms and Accessibility

PUBG supports multiple platforms, enabling a wide range of players to experience its intense battles:

1. PC (Steam / Official Client)

High-quality graphics and customizable settings allow players to adjust visuals, frame rates, and controls according to their preferences. Precision mouse aiming and hotkeys enhance combat, especially for competitive players. The large PC player base ensures fast matchmaking and a competitive atmosphere.

2. Consoles (PlayStation 4 / Xbox One)

Console players can experience PUBG on a big screen with optimized controller controls. Driving and tactical movement feel smooth, and combined with audio-visual setups, immersion is enhanced. Cross-platform features allow interaction with PC players for shared content and tournaments.

3. Mobile (PUBG Mobile)

Optimized for touch controls, PUBG Mobile allows players to enjoy intense gameplay on the go. Simple interfaces make shooting, looting, and driving intuitive. Cross-server matchmaking and social features enable team play anytime, anywhere—from commuting to casual play.

Cross-Platform and Community Activity

Multi-platform support improves convenience and boosts community activity. Players on different devices can share strategies, exchange experiences, and participate in cross-platform competitions, forming a diverse player ecosystem. PUBG delivers high-quality battle experiences regardless of device, immersing players in the tension of island survival.
